Web11 sep. 2024 · Another way to remove a permanent marker stain from your car’s paint is to use rubbing alcohol. Apply the rubbing alcohol to a clean cloth and rub the stained area until the stain is gone. If you have a white car, you can also try using toothpaste. WebThe simple answer is that permanent fabric markers do not wash out. The ink used in these pens is not water-soluble. This means that water does not dissolve the ink and cannot remove it from the material. Toothpaste works well for paper ink stain removal because of the bleaching agents it contains. But because toothpaste is also abrasive, use it with caution to avoid damaging the paper as you attempt to remove the permanent ink stain. This method would work best on thicker paper types -- cardboard -- that can resist tearing ...
Web19 feb. 2015 · Be gentle and don't rub wildly and it should come off. Rubbing alcohol. Either spill some rubbing alcohol on the surface or dab some of the paper towel in the alcohol. Then, start rubbing over the permanent marker area until it comes out (it may take a few reapplications) or it won't come out any more.
